  • Jul 1, 1932
    Victor releases Jimmie Rodgers' "Home Call" and "She Was Happy Till She Met You"
    Jul 21, 1932
    Jimmie Rodgers wires fiddler Clayton McMichen from Gadsden, Alabama, asking the former Skillet Licker to record with him. McMichen obliges, injecting morphine into Rodgers' veins during the sessions to quell the pain of tuberculosis
    Aug 10, 1932
    Jimmie Rodgers records "In The Hills Of Tennessee" at the Victor Studio in Camden, New Jersey. The recording remains unissued, as he remakes it 19 days later
    Aug 11, 1932
    Jimmie Rodgers records "Mother, The Queen Of My Heart," "Prohibition Has Done Me Wrong," "Rock All Our Babies To Sleep" and "Whippin' That Old T.B." at the Victor Studio in Camden, New Jersey. "Prohibition" goes unissued
    Aug 12, 1932
    Victor releases Jimmie Rodgers' "Blue Yodel No. 10" and "Mississippi Moon"
    Aug 29, 1932
    Jimmie Rodgers records four songs in a New York session at the Victor Studios: "In The Hills Of Tennessee," "Miss The Mississippi And You," "Prairie Lullaby" and "Sweet Mama Hurry Home"
    Sep 23, 1932
    Victor releases Jimmie Rodgers' two-sided single, "Hobo's Meditation" and "Down The Old Road To Home"
    Oct 21, 1932
    Victor releases Jimmie Rodgers' "Mother, The Queen Of My Heart" and "Rock All Our Babies To Sleep"
    Dec 2, 1932
    Victor releases Jimmie Rodgers' "In The Hills Of Tennessee" with "Miss The Mississippi And You"
    Jan 13, 1933
    Victor releases Jimmie Rodgers' "Whippin' That Old T.B." and "No Hard Times"
